Key Features
- Durable construction: High impact copolymer resists oil, petroleum and most household chemicals so the surface stays intact under typical garage conditions.
- High load capacity: The material and design support rolling loads over 40,000 lbs, which gives confidence for cars, equipment and rolling tool cabinets.
- Snap-together installation: Patented PowerLock Technology lets tiles snap together quickly with no tools, glue or extra hands required, cutting install time for a single installer.
- Slip resistant surface: The coin top pattern provides traction and reduces the risk of slipping while remaining simple to clean with a mop or shop vac.
- Stain resistant finish: The durable surface won't readily stain from car oil and dirt, making maintenance minimal compared with painted or epoxy floors.
Who It's For
The GarageDeck coin pattern tiles are aimed at homeowners who want a showroom look in their garage without hiring a contractor, and for DIYers who value a quick, tool-free install. They work well for two-car garages, utility rooms, workshop spaces and areas where chemical and oil resistance matter.
These tiles are less appealing for buyers seeking a permanently bonded floor finish or a seamless epoxy surface, and those who require custom trimming of unusual contours should plan for careful cutting and layout before starting the install.

Specifications
| Brand | Big Floors |
| Pattern | Coin top |
| Material | High impact copolymer (non-toxic) |
| Tile size | 12 in x 12 in |
| Pack count | 48 tiles |
| Chemical resistance | Resistant to oil, grease, petroleum, antifreeze and most household chemicals |

Frequently Asked Questions
Can one person install these tiles?
Yes. The patented PowerLock snap-together system is designed for easy single-person installation without tools or glue.
Will the tiles resist car oil and spills?
Yes. The copolymer surface is resistant to oil, grease and most household chemicals and is designed to be easy to clean.
Do tiles need a special subfloor?
No special subfloor is required; tiles lay over a clean, dry concrete surface and support heavy rolling loads.
